Kylie Jenner’s daughter, Stormi Webster, dissed her famous mother’s “King Kylie” era.
On Monday, the Khy founder posted a TikTok video featuring the amusing response of her 7-year-old to an old picture of the reality star sporting a blue wig.
“Did you dye your hair in that picture?” asked Stormi, surprised. Jenner replied, “No, it was a wig. Mommy used to enjoy wearing wigs, especially colorful ones.”
“A blue wig with red outfit?” Stormi questioned her mom, with her eyes wide open in disbelief and her hands on her hips.
“I know. It’s not good,” the “Kardashians” star, 27, conceded.
“It’s not a good combo!” Stormi chimed in shadily, before saying to the camera, “That’s what she gets.”
“Stormi just discovered the king kylie era,” the makeup mogul captioned the clip.
Fans flocked to the comments with their thoughts, including one who said, “Eventually, she’ll grasp the full cultural importance of the king kylie era.”
“She doesn’t know King Kylie paid for that house,” another joked.
A third quipped that only the Kylie Cosmetics founder could pull off the colored wigs.
The “Keeping Up With the Kardashians” alum became for stepping out in vibrant multi-colored wigs in the mid-2010s.
At the time, she adopted the “King Kylie” nickname, even changing her Instagram handle to @kingkylie in 2015.
The style era roughly lasted from 2014 to 2016, though Jenner occasionally drops reminders of the brief period with pastel-colored and teal wigs.
The reality star previously shared that she outgrew the beloved era, especially after welcoming Stormi and 3-year-old son Aire Webster with Travis Scott.
“That era will always be a part of who I am, but it’ll never be what it was when I was younger,” Jenner told Elle magazine in October 2024.
